Overview

Postcode B26 1PD is located in a major urban area, within the Sheldon ward of Birmingham in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Yardley South area. It has high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 72.2 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Yardley South is £51,342 per year. The nearest station is Acocks Green located about 1.1 miles away. There are 8 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.

Property prices in Sheldon

Based on 237 recent sales, the median property price is £250,000 in Sheldon area, with individual transactions ranging from £35,000 up to £503,000.
